Studying Online at Dakota County Technical College
Many students take online classes at Dakota County Technical College. Of 2,894 students, 621 (21%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 766 (26%) took at least some classes online.

Earnings for Health/Medical Admin Services Graduates from Dakota County Technical College
Students who complete Dakota County Technical College’s Health/Medical Admin Services program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 2 years | $26,933 |
| 3 years | $34,683 |
| 4 years | $31,290 |
| 5 years | $42,837 |
How do these earnings stack up against the rest of the school? At the four-year mark, Health/Medical Admin Services graduates from Dakota County Technical College earn a median of $31,290, compared with $49,491 for all Dakota County Technical College graduates — about 37% lower than the school-wide median.
Student Demographics & Diversity
The following sections describe the student demographics for Health/Medical Admin Services graduates at Dakota County Technical College, broken down by degree level.
Program-wide, Health/Medical Admin Services graduates at Dakota County Technical College are 96% women (26) and 4% men (1).
Health/Medical Admin Services Associate’s Program at Dakota County Technical College
Of the 16 associate’s health/medical admin services degrees awarded at Dakota County Technical College, 100% were women (16) and 0% were men (0).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Health/Medical Admin Services associate’s degree recipients at Dakota County Technical College.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 12 |
| Black / African American | 2 |
| Asian | 1 |
| American Indian / Alaska Native | 1 |
Minority students account for 25% of Health/Medical Admin Services associate’s degree recipients at Dakota County Technical College, lower than the national average of 56%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
